Section 28-35-181q - Special licenses concerning gas and aerosol detectors containing radioactive material other than by-product, source or special nuclear material
Current through Register Vol. 43, No. 52, December 26, 2024
(a) An application for a specific license to manufacture, process, produce or transfer gas and aerosol detectors which contain radioactive material other than source, by-product, or special nuclear material, and which are designed to protect life or property from fires and airborne hazards, shall not be approved unless the applicant submits the information required by the United States nuclear regulatory commission under 10 CFR sections 32.26 and 32.27, as in effect on March 31, 1983, for similar devices containing by-product material.
